What is the cost of ropeway?

The average cost of a ropeway is Rs 50 crore per kilometre, which can further reduce to Rs 20-30 crore with indigenous components. Ropeway has multiple cars propelled by a single power-plant and drive mechanism which reduces both construction and maintenance costs.09-Feb-2022

What is difference between ropeway and cable car?

In Japan, the two are considered as the same category of vehicle and called ropeway, while the term cable car refers to both grounded cable cars and funiculars. An aerial railway where the vehicles are suspended from a fixed track (as opposed to a cable) is known as a suspension railway.

How are ropeways made?

Assembly of the rope: After the structural parts of the stations and the line have been fitted, it is time to tension the rope. The rope assembly is completed by splicing the rope. The assembly of the rope is the most interesting, but typically also the most difficult part of the building of a ropeway.

Where do we use ropeways?

Ropeways are mature, efficient and comfortable means of transport that are used mainly in the areas of winter sports and tourism. Thanks to their specific characteristics, such as flexibility and cost efficiency, ropeways are also gaining in importance as a means of transport in urban areas.
